WebSONOS Net and Wired Ethernet - what a difference! I finally got around to hard-wiring my beam (along with various other media components) and switching everything over to SONOSNet - It's made a massive difference, especially for the devices that were just on the edge of the WiFi signal! Follow the steps in the app to … lutherisch lippeWebOpen the Sonos S2 app for iOS or Android. From the Settings tab, press System > Network > Manage Networks. Press Update Networks and follow the prompts to connect Sonos to your Wi-Fi network. Once the wireless setup is complete, disconnect the Ethernet cable from any Sonos products wired to your router.
